All shampoos, lotions, shower gels, antiperspirants, and even toothpaste found in today’s market contain one or more of the following ingredients.
Aluminum - found in antiperspirants, is a neurotoxin or “nerve poison” that acts specifically on nerve cells.
Phthalates - phthalates are used to give lotions its creamy texture. Phthalates are a hormone disruptor and are highly toxic. Studies done on rodents involving phthalates have been shown to damage the liver, testes and cause birth defects.
Sodium Lauryl Sulfate (SLS) - mostly found in shower gels, also disrupts hormones and is a surfactant. Possible effects include hormone imbalance, eye deformities in children, skin irritations and numerous other causes.
Parabens - is a preservative found in almost everything and is most commonly listed as ethyl-paraben or methyl paraben. Paraben can mimic the hormone estrogen and can cause havoc to your hormonal balance and have been found in cancerous lumps and adhesions.
These are some of the more common ingredients to avoid and here are a few more to look out for: dimethicone, petro-chemicals, artificial colors and fragrances, triethanolamine, and mineral oils.

Some of these things cost very little extra and reap huge benefits for the environment. Here's a few things anyone planning a new home may consider:
- Living in a tropical climate, we are blessed with an abundant supply of rainfall. Plan a way to collect rainwater and use this water to flush toilets, dish-washing or even watering your plants. Make sure that you install a diverter to your main water supply once the rainwater runs out.
- Always use a VOC-free paint. VOC(volatile organic compounds) not only harm the environment but your health as well. VOC- free paints are easily washable and non-toxic too.! ICI has a spectrum of colors and textures to choose from and smell great.
- The best investment you can make for your home would be a water filtration system. Since the local water supply should not be used for drinking or cooking(yes, its true,) a water filtration system would allow you to do both without having to buy bottled water! Saving money in the long run and not to mention all the plastic bottles that do not get recycled!! Remember to buy a few extra filters with your purchase, as you would need replace them every few months.
